Have you guys seen the planets this week? It's way too cool to miss! Look in the western sky if it isn't cloudy tonight: you will see Venus and Jupiter thisclose together! Venus is the brighter one because it is closer to us, but I have heard that even if you have a smallish telescope you can seen at least four of Jupiter's moons. :-) Then, after seeing them, turn around and face east: you can also see Mars super-clearly! It's that small red planet midway up in the eastern sky. Overall a great time for looking skyward!
